Subject: Lost laptop and data security issueOS: xpCPU/Ram: 500Manufacturer/Model: dell |
Comment: a user in my company lost his office (vpn) laptop for several days (win xp). but was later recovered from the police. being an enterprise domain user, and lots of confidential data in this PC. what specifically are the things/areas we need to check out both in this laptop and in the entire domain to verify that an unauthorised user has not compromised this computer, or even used this laptop to gain access to our enterprise network?. this is w2k domain, dhcp, wins, etc LAN with multiple remote sites

Reply: Assume the data/machine was compromised. You may also want to invest in a data Encryption program. Lots of companies are doing that now, and the Government is now starting to require it after the VA mess a couple of years ago. Life's more painless for the brainless.
